Analysis

In 2023, multidimensional poverty headcount ratio (world bank) in Iran, Islamic Republic of stood at 2.5%. That is the lowest value across all 13 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 13.8% on the previous year and down 21.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, multidimensional poverty headcount ratio (world bank) in Iran, Islamic Republic of peaked at 4.7% in 2020 and was at its lowest, 2.5%, in 2023.

That places Iran, Islamic Republic of 19th out of 68 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

Multidimensional poverty headcount ratio (World Bank) in Iran, Islamic Republic of, year by year

Annual values for Multidimensional poverty headcount ratio (World Bank) (% of population) in Iran, Islamic Republic of, 2011 to 2023.
Year % of population Change
2011 3.8%
2012 3.0% -21.1%
2013 3.2% +6.7%
2014 3.5% +9.4%
2015 3.1% -11.4%
2016 3.1% +0.0%
2017 2.8% -9.7%
2018 3.3% +17.9%
2019 4.3% +30.3%
2020 4.7% +9.3%
2021 3.8% -19.1%
2022 2.9% -23.7%
2023 2.5% -13.8%

The multidimensional poverty headcount ratio (World Bank) is the percentage of a population living in poverty according to the World Bank's Multidimensional Poverty Measure. The Multidimensional Poverty Measure includes three dimensions – monetary poverty, education, and basic infrastructure services – to capture a more complete picture of poverty.
